2. Enhancement Framework — Decision Table
| Scenario | Recommended Approach | Notes |
|---|---|---|
| Classic user exit exists | SMOD / CMOD | ECC only — avoid in new S/4HANA dev |
| BAdI definition exists | New BAdI (SE19 / GET BADI) | All releases — preferred approach |
| No exit/BAdI, on-premise | Enhancement Spot (SE18/SE19) | CBO allowed on-premise |
| S/4HANA Clean Core / Cloud PE | BTP side-by-side extension (RAP + Events) | No on-stack modifications |

BAPI with Complete Error Handling
DATA lt_return TYPE TABLE OF bapiret2.
CALL FUNCTION 'BAPI_NAME'
EXPORTING
iv_param1 = lv_value1
iv_param2 = lv_value2
IMPORTING
ev_result = lv_result
TABLES
return = lt_return.
" ALWAYS check return table — never assume success
IF line_exists( lt_return[ type = 'E' ] )
OR line_exists( lt_return[ type = 'A' ] ).
" Error — do NOT commit; handle or raise
LOOP AT lt_return INTO DATA(ls_err) WHERE type CA 'EA'.
MESSAGE ls_err-message TYPE 'E'.
ENDLOOP.
ELSE.
" Success — commit
CALL FUNCTION 'BAPI_TRANSACTION_COMMIT'
EXPORTING wait = abap_true.
ENDIF.

4. Performance Troubleshooting
Short Dump Types (ST22)
| Dump Type | Root Cause | Fix |
|---|---|---|
| TIME_LIMIT_EXCEEDED | Infinite loop / unoptimized mass processing | Add CHECK sy-tabix MOD 100 = 0. in loop; optimize SQL |
| MEMORY_NO_MORE_PAGING | SELECT * on large table / massive internal table | Select specific fields; use PACKAGE SIZE for batch processing |
| RAISE_EXCEPTION unhandled | TRY-CATCH missing | Wrap in TRY-CATCH block for specific exception class |
| COMPUTE_INT_ZERODIVIDE | Division by zero in calculation | Add zero-check before division |
| OBJECTS_OBJREF_NOT_ASSIGNED | Object reference is initial (null pointer) | Add IS BOUND check before method call |
SQL Performance (SE30 / SAT Runtime Analysis)
Bad patterns:
" Full table scan — NEVER do this
SELECT * FROM mara INTO TABLE @DATA(lt_mara).
" SELECT inside loop — N+1 query problem
LOOP AT lt_orders INTO DATA(ls_order).
SELECT SINGLE * FROM mara INTO @DATA(ls_mat)
WHERE matnr = @ls_order-matnr. " Called N times!
ENDLOOP.
Good patterns:
" Targeted fields + WHERE clause
SELECT matnr, maktx, mtart, meins
FROM mara
INTO TABLE @DATA(lt_mara)
WHERE mtart = 'FERT'
AND mstae = ' '.
" FOR ALL ENTRIES — single query for all orders
SELECT matnr, maktx
FROM mara
INTO TABLE @DATA(lt_mara)
FOR ALL ENTRIES IN @lt_orders
WHERE matnr = @lt_orders-matnr.
5. S/4HANA Deprecated Objects → Replacements
| Deprecated | Use Instead | Notes |
|---|---|---|
| SELECT from BSEG | I_JournalEntryItem (CDS) |
ACDOCA is source in S/4HANA |
| SELECT from BSID/BSAD | I_CustomerLineItem (CDS) |
|
| SELECT from BSIK/BSAK | I_SupplierLineItem (CDS) |
|
| SELECT from MKPF/MSEG | I_MaterialDocumentItem (CDS) |
MATDOC is source |
| SELECT * from MARA without WHERE | Targeted CDS view with filter | Performance + compatibility |
| CALL TRANSACTION | BAPI / RAP action / function module | Compatibility issue |
| Logical DB PNPCE | Direct SELECT + AUTHORITY-CHECK | Deprecated in S/4HANA |
| Old BAdI (CL_EXITHANDLER) | New BAdI (GET BADI) | Supported but old style |
| COMMUNICATION statements | RFC / web service | Obsolete |

6. Universal Code Review Checklist
Performance:
□ No SELECT * — only specific fields needed
□ All DB reads have WHERE clause on primary/indexed fields
□ No SELECT inside LOOP — use FOR ALL ENTRIES or JOIN
□ PACKAGE SIZE used for mass data reads
Error Handling:
□ All BAPI calls check RETURN table for E/A type messages
□ All method calls on object references: IS BOUND check
□ TRY-CATCH blocks for risky operations (file I/O, conversions)
□ No COMMIT WORK inside loops
Security:
□ AUTHORITY-CHECK implemented for sensitive data access
□ No hardcoded passwords, API keys, or credentials
□ Input validation before database writes
Clean Core / S/4HANA Compatibility:
□ No direct SELECT on deprecated tables (BSEG, MKPF/MSEG)
□ No CALL TRANSACTION in background-capable programs
□ No modifications to SAP standard objects (use enhancements)
Technical:
□ No hardcoded org values (company code, plant, G/L accounts)
□ Unicode-compatible: SE38 → Program Attributes → Unicode checked
□ Program type correct (Type 1 for reports, M for module pool)
□ Transport request assigned and documented
Quality:
□ ABAP Unit test class included
□ ATC (ABAP Test Cockpit) check clean — no Priority 1 or 2 findings
□ Code formatted with Pretty Printer (Shift+F1)
□ Comments in English for shared / international teams
